Webb22.87% of adults who report experiencing 14 or more mentally unhealthy days each month were not able to see a doctor due to costs. In Georgia (ranked 51), over one-third of adults experiencing frequent mental distress are unable to afford a doctor’s visit. 59.8% of youth with major depression do not receive any mental health treatment.
Webb3 mars 2024 · We also know the consequences of these two conditions are different. Burnout leads to a higher rate of medical errors. Depression by itself doesn't seem to lead to a higher rate of medical errors.
